About N-[(2,4-difluorophenyl)methyl]-2-[[5-(ethylcarbamoylamino)-2-pyridinyl]oxy]acetamide
N-[(2,4-difluorophenyl)methyl]-2-[[5-(ethylcarbamoylamino)-2-pyridinyl]oxy]acetamide (PubChem CID 53175069) has the molecular formula C17H18F2N4O3
and a molecular weight of 364.35 g/mol. Its IUPAC name is N-[(2,4-difluorophenyl)methyl]-2-[[5-(ethylcarbamoylamino)-2-pyridinyl]oxy]acetamide.

What is the SMILES notation for N-[(2,4-difluorophenyl)methyl]-2-[[5-(ethylcarbamoylamino)-2-pyridinyl]oxy]acetamide?
The canonical SMILES for N-[(2,4-difluorophenyl)methyl]-2-[[5-(ethylcarbamoylamino)-2-pyridinyl]oxy]acetamide is CCNC(=O)Nc1ccc(OCC(=O)NCc2ccc(F)cc2F)nc1.
What is the InChIKey of N-[(2,4-difluorophenyl)methyl]-2-[[5-(ethylcarbamoylamino)-2-pyridinyl]oxy]acetamide?
The InChIKey is UATKDUJRGRWGLE-UHFFFAOYSA-N. The full InChI is InChI=1S/C17H18F2N4O3/c1-2-20-17(25)23-13-5-6-16(22-9-13)26-10-15(24)21-8-11-3-4-12(18)7-14(11)19/h3-7,9H,2,8,10H2,1H3,(H,21,24)(H2,20,23,25).
What are the key properties of N-[(2,4-difluorophenyl)methyl]-2-[[5-(ethylcarbamoylamino)-2-pyridinyl]oxy]acetamide?
N-[(2,4-difluorophenyl)methyl]-2-[[5-(ethylcarbamoylamino)-2-pyridinyl]oxy]acetamide has a molecular weight of 364.35 g/mol, XLogP of 2.20, 7 rotatable bonds, 3 hydrogen bond donors, and 4 hydrogen bond acceptors.
